Understanding Construction Wire Mesh Its Importance and Applications


Construction wire mesh is an integral component in the field of civil engineering and construction. This versatile material, made from steel wires that are woven or welded together, serves various essential functions in building structures. Recognizing its importance and applications can help builders and construction professionals make informed decisions regarding their projects.


Wire mesh is primarily used for reinforcing concrete. When concrete is in its freshly poured state, it is quite weak and susceptible to cracking under pressure or when subjected to external forces. By incorporating wire mesh into concrete slabs, walls, and foundations, the structural integrity is significantly enhanced. The mesh distributes the tensile load, ensuring that any stress encountered is evenly spread out across the concrete surface. This reinforcement is crucial, particularly in structures designed to bear heavy loads or those subjected to fluctuating temperature changes that can cause expansion and contraction.


Another key application of construction wire mesh is in the creation of fences and barriers. Welded wire mesh offers security and durability, making it ideal for enclosing perimeters in residential, commercial, and industrial properties. Its strength discourages unauthorized access and protects against intruders while remaining visually appealing. Additionally, wire mesh can also be used for landscaping purposes, serving as a support structure for climbing plants or as decorative dividers.

In road construction, wire mesh plays a critical role as well. It is often utilized in the reinforcement of asphalt overlays, ensuring that the surface maintains its structure and integrity over time. This is especially important in regions with heavy traffic or extreme weather conditions, where the risk of pavement failure is higher.


Moreover, wire mesh is an excellent choice for creating formwork in precast concrete elements. The mesh provides additional strength to elements such as beams, columns, and panels, ensuring they can endure the pressures encountered during transportation and installation.


In recent years, there has been a growing emphasis on sustainability in construction. Wire mesh is typically made from recyclable materials, which aligns with eco-friendly practices. Its longevity and strength contribute to reduced maintenance and replacement costs over time, making it a cost-effective choice for many projects.


In conclusion, construction wire mesh is a vital material that supports various functions across a wide array of construction applications. Its ability to reinforce concrete, provide security, and serve as a sustainable building solution makes it an indispensable asset in modern construction practices. As the industry continues to evolve, the demand for high-quality wire mesh is likely to grow, underscoring its ongoing relevance in building safe and durable structures.
